Space Mirrors that could Light up the Earth

Science In Action

Available for over a year

Znamya 2.5, a giant mirror is being launched, part of Russian-US research into whether orbiting space mirrors could illuminate Earth. Brazilian scientists are making life-saving snake-bite antidotes by injecting chickens with venom and collecting the antibodies from the eggs. A new man-made element, Number 114 on the Periodic Table, is produced. Hear what comet dust particles could sound like when they collide with a new probe, Nasa's Stardust mission.
